In Batman- The Brave and the Bold, comics' top writers and artists take on the citizens of Gotham City-and beyond-in a one-of-a-kind anthology series, presenting tales you won't find anywhere else. Batman- The Brave and the Bold Vol. 2 is headlined by "Batman- Pygmalion," a story both written and drawn by superstar artist Guillem March. An injured Batman wakes up in an unfamiliar home-but when he's face to face with another Dark Knight, who's really pulling the strings Plus, Superman is confronted with a relic from his past-sparking an enigmatic era-spanning adventure-in "Order of the Black Lamp" from writer and Halt and Catch Fire co-creator Christopher Cantwell, and acclaimed artist Javier Rodriguez. Finally, fan-favorite vigilante Wild Dog looks to find his place in the crimefighting landscape in "Here Comes Trouble" from Peacemaker Tries Hard! writer Kyle Starks and Green Lantern artist Fernando Pasarin! This volume collects stories from Batman- The Brave and the Bold #1-3 and #6-9.
Guillem March is a Mallorca-based artist known for his prolific tenure at DC, including work on high-profile series including Gotham City Sirens, Catwoman, The Joker, Justice League Dark, and Batman. on DC titles such as Catwoman and Batman. In 2023, he both wrote and drew "Pygmalion," a featured story in anthology series Batman- The Brave and the Bold.
